What is a law in the scientific method?

In the scientific method, a law is a statement that describes a consistent and universal relationship observed in nature, often expressed mathematically. Laws summarize empirical observations and can predict outcomes under specific conditions. Unlike theories, which provide explanations for phenomena, laws simply describe what happens based on repeated experimental evidence. An example is Newton's Law of Universal Gravitation, which mathematically describes the gravitational attraction between masses.

What is the difference in assigned and real charge in chemistry?

The real charge on an electron is -1.60217646 x 10-19 Coulombs. The charge on a proton is +1.60217646 x 10-19 Coulombs. Because these values are cumbersome to work with, and are equal but opposite, the protons were assigned a charge of +1, and electrons were assigned a charge of -1.

Predict the following chemical formula for a compound between Al and S?

The chemical formula for a compound between Al and S is Al2S3. Aluminum typically forms a 3+ cation and sulfur typically forms a 2- anion. To balance the charges, you need two aluminum atoms for every three sulfur atoms.


Predict formulas for stable binary ionic compounds based on balance of charges?

To predict formulas for stable binary ionic compounds, determine the charges of the ions involved. The compound's formula should reflect a balance of positive and negative charges to achieve overall neutrality. For example, in sodium chloride (NaCl), sodium has a +1 charge and chloride has a -1 charge, resulting in a stable compound with a 1:1 ratio.

Predict what the formula would be for a compound formed between potassium and sulphur?

The formula for a compound formed between potassium and sulfur would be K2S, as potassium has a +1 charge and sulfur has a -2 charge. This results in a 2:1 ratio of potassium ions to sulfur ions to balance the charges in the compound.
